Pros

Nice facilities, some very talented people (although many have left), good co-workers.

Cons

This was absolutely the worst work experience of my life, and the longest 13 months. Going to work each day was met with a mix of total dread and curiosity to see what wacky management decision or personnel move was going to be made that day. This company has no direction, no leadership and sadly most likely no future. Senior management is more worried about the President's reactions than making good business decisions. It's fun to watch Directors and VP's spend their days trying not to make decisions that may attract attention. Employees hardly ever last a full year, there is such a high turn over rate at all levels that there is just no continuity. Really not the place you want to try and make a career of. When I recently interviewed for another position the VP I met with commented "another Overstock employee looking for a change, I get a lot of you guys". Just look at the number of senior management that have left this year alone.

Pros

Really liked working with my immediate team. Made some lifelong friends

Cons

Upper management is a disaster. Way too big of a company to be managed by friends rather than talent. It's getting worse, anyone with good ideas is seen as a threat and chased off. Unhealthy work environment characterized by bullying, unwarranted attacks, and illogical demands by leaders who don't understand either specific problems or big picture targets. Odd ascension of leaders who lack both technical talent and big ideas - seems like at least one should be present.

Pros

Some of the coworkers are very nice.

Cons

I've seen some people get fired for no good reason and a lot of people are terrified that they'll lose their jobs because of it, especially in marketing and merchandising - I was getting pretty close to one intern and she was learning quickly, even doing her job better than her supervisor could do it judging from the sales, but she was fired because she didn't 'mesh' well. Which basically means that her supervisor just didn't like her, even though she did her job. And the CEO prides himself on taking his employees concerns seriously, but he just comes across as being really defensive.
